All, For the record, the correct commit message should have been: [driver] Revert r141053+r141055+r141078, which causes clang to warn if the user has requested debug information and we're using the integrated assembler. This is more trouble then it's worth and causes a number of failures in the GCC testsuite. Reverts rdar://10216353, but fixes rdar://10232115
